It's the fourth anniversary of Transistor's public launch! In
this two-part series, Jon and Justin answer your questions.


01:22 - Our history

14:51 - What is the secret to running Transistor as a
company? See our values here.

21:19 - What was the most challenging aspect of the past 4
years?

22:14 - Where do you see Transistor at 5 or 10 year?

26:19 - Do you ever feel like you're not doing enough? Book:
Running the Dream.

32:09 - Have we reached peak podcast?

34:36 - What's something you've gotten better at over the
past 4 years?

38:23 - What was the lowest point in Transistor's history?

40:09 - What have you learned about partnership?

43:17 - What has been the most fun memory of your journey?

47:04 - What is the definition of enough for Transistor?

50:49 - What are your thoughts on open startups vs private?

52:25 - What are the most impactful decisions you've made?

56:34 - How has your job changed year to year?
